## What Ascent Peptides is

Ascent Peptides is an independent editorial digest covering the published research on three peptides studied for the **growth hormone axis**: CJC-1295, Sermorelin and Tesamorelin, with CJC-1295 as the lead. The site exists to make a scattered and frequently overstated literature legible — to tell a reader, in plain language and with citations, what each GHRH analog was actually studied for, in which populations, and how far that evidence reaches.

The organizing frame is the GH-axis secretagogue class: three compounds that share a receptor target (the pituitary GHRH receptor) and a basic mechanism (upstream stimulation of the GH/IGF-1 axis), but diverge sharply in their structural durability strategies, their half-lives, and their depth of human evidence. Reading them as a group reveals both what the class can do in principle and where each individual compound's evidence actually ends. Each compound has its own page; a comparison page lines them up side by side; and a single shared references list aggregates every source.

## How it is compiled

Three principles govern what appears on this site.

*First, everything is anchored to the peer-reviewed literature.* Every research claim is tied to a numbered citation — PubMed-indexed journal articles, reviews and official monographs — collected on the [references page](/references). Where a finding comes from a review or editorial rather than a primary study, the review or editorial is cited as such, and its status as secondary commentary is noted.

*Second, the evidence is described at its true strength.* Doses and outcomes are described in the species and context in which they were studied — "raised mean GH 2- to 10-fold in healthy adults" or "reduced visceral fat in HIV-infected adults on antiretroviral therapy" — never scaled to general recommendations. Where an approved indication exists, it is described in its approved terms; off-label questions are framed as research questions. Where editorial opinion explicitly cautions against a use, that caution appears prominently, not as a footnote.

*Third, the three pages are cross-referenced.* Because the same receptor, the same GH/IGF-1 axis, and the same DPP-IV stability problem recur across all three compounds, the pages link to one another so a reader can follow a design choice or an evidence gap from one analog to the next.

## What it is not

Ascent Peptides is not a store, not a clinic, and not a source of medical advice. It does not sell, supply, source or broker any peptide or research chemical, and it has no affiliate or referral relationship with any vendor. It does not employ clinicians, diagnose conditions, or prescribe anything. It does not recommend a dose, schedule, or route of administration for any person.

The peptides discussed here are research compounds or, in the case of tesamorelin, a prescription drug approved for a specific indication. None is an over-the-counter supplement; several are explicitly prohibited in sport. Readers interested in conditions described in the underlying research should consult a licensed clinician operating within their own jurisdiction, working with regulated, evidence-based options. This site offers a careful reading of the research literature — nothing more, and nothing it pretends to be.
